Observations of Low-Frequency Waves Excited by Newborn Interstellar Pickup He+ as Seen by the Ulysses Spacecraft

Abstract
We report an analysis of low-frequency waves in the Ulysses magnetic field data that arise from newborn interstellar pickup He+. Ulysses observations of waves excited by interstellar H+ have already been reported, but in this analysis we identify waves due to the ionization of He atoms. While neutral He can reach inside 1 AU in significant numbers whereas interstellar neutral H cannot, we find that most of the waves due to He+ are seen at moderate to low heliolatitude beyond 3 AU. This may reflect the nature of the orbit where Ulysses spends a greater fraction of its time in this region, or it may reflect the turbulence conditions. Our analysis will address this and related questions.
